Semiconductor Manufacturing International Corp 2022 AR2
The report highlights Semiconductor Manufacturing International Corporation's (SMIC) record-breaking financial and operational performance for the fiscal year 2022, with revenue reaching approximately 7.3 billion USD. SMIC continued to expand its manufacturing capacity, with monthly capacity reaching 714,000 8-inch wafer equivalents and total shipments of 7,098,458 wafers. On the environmental front, the company invested 190 million USD in environmental protection, implementing 28 carbon reduction projects that achieved an annual reduction of approximately 6,576 tons of CO2 equivalent. Additionally, SMIC continued its social contributions, notably through its 'Liver Transplant Program for Children' which has helped 745 children to date.
